Description

This form is a Purchase and Intellectual Property Assignment for Software. The assignor agrees to transfer all ownership rights, including intellectual property rights in the described software to the assignee. All parties acknowledge that they have read the agreement and voluntarily agree to all terms and conditions of the assignment.

Software can be both patented and copyrighted, depending on its nature. Copyright protects the expression of ideas in the software, while a patent protects the underlying technology or method that the software uses. In a Texas Purchase And Intellectual Property Assignment For Software, you should consider both forms of protection to maximize your rights and prevent unauthorized use.

Yes, Texas law allows for the assignment of contracts, which includes intellectual property agreements. This means the original party can transfer their rights and obligations to another party, provided the contract does not prohibit such assignments.
